2. MATERIAL / VT T
2.1. Strand / Cp
Seven-wire stress-relieved strand
Cp d ng lc loi 7 si

Nominal Diameter
ng knh danh nh 12.7 mm

Nominal Area
Din tch mt ct danh nh 98.7 mm2

Nominal Weight
Trng lng danh nh 0.785 kg/m

Yield Strength
Gii hn chy 1670 MPa

Tensile Strength
Gii hn bn 1860 Mpa

Minimum Breaking Load


Lc ko t cp ti thiu 183.7 kN

Modulus of Elasticity
Mun n hi 195 10 GPa

Relaxation max 2.5% at 70% of GUTS


or max 3.5% at 80% of GUTS
chng ti a 2.5% ti 70% ca gii hn bn ti hn
hoc 3.5% ti 80% ca gii hn bn ti hn
Identification Tag on each coil with heat and coil no
Nhn mc Bng nh trn mi cun cp ghi r s hiu cun v s m

Certificates Mill certificate for each shipment


Chng ch Chng ch cp cho mi l hng.

Strand quality in accordance to ASTM A416 Grade 270


Cht lng cp theo tiu chun ASTM A416 Grade 270
Strand will be tested for each 20 tons for one sample with 3 strands will be taken from nominated strand coil by
Consultant/Owner.
Cp s c th nghim cho mi 20 tn cho mt t mu 3 si s c ly t cun cp c ch nh bi T vn
gim st hoc Ch u t .

2.3. Anti-Bursting Reinforcement / Ct thp gia cng cho u neo


Anti-bursting reinforcement for stressing anchorages and dead end anchorages is steel cage that has rectangular or
spiral ties in shape as per the shop drawings (provided and installed by the Main Contractor).
Ct thp gia cng cho u neo ko v u neo cht c dng lng thp hnh ch nht nh trong bn v thi cng
(do nh thu chnh cung cp v lp t) .

2.4. Barchair / Con k


The tendon profile is achieved by using bar chair supported at 800 mm up to 1200 mm intervals to the under side
of the tendon unless noted otherwise.
Cc ng cp c bng cc con k t cch nha u 800mm ti 1 200mm pha di ca ng tr khi
c quy nh khc.

Bar chairs with height varies should be made by steel like strand or steel. The bottom part of the bar chair is
painted for corrosion protection.
Cc thanh vi chiu cao khc nhau phi c l m bng tao cp hoc thp. Chn ca thanh c ph sn
chng g.
At beam location, tendons can be normally supported on horizontal bars (supplied by MC) fixed to stirrups or
suspended to the top reinforcement with tie wire where appropriate.
Ti v tr dm, cc ng cp thng c k trn thanh nm ngang (cung cp bi MC), gn c nh vi ct
ai hoc c treo vo ct ch pha trn v buc ti v tr thch hp.
At the highest and lowest points, the tendon can be fixed to top and bottom layer of rebar to achieve their profile
without bar chair.
Ti cc im cao nht v thp nht, ng cp c th c nh vo lp thp trn cng v di cng t c
bin dng mong mun m khng cn n con k .

2.6. Plastic Grout Vent / Van bm va bng nha


Intermediate plastic grout vents are provided at highest points along the tendon allow water and air can flow
outside. NC recommends avoiding installing grout vents at lowest points since the outlet here is difficult to seal
and may cause blockage. A distance between vents varies with duct type and size, tendon profile, grouting
procedures and equipment used, normally 30m of maximum is applied.
Van bm va bng nha c t cc im cao nht dc theo ng cp cho php nc v kh c th thot ra.
Nam Cng khuyn co khng nn lp van bm va ti im thp nht bi v vi v tr ny rt kh qun kn v do
c th gy r r trong qu trnh b tng. Kho ng cch gia cc van bm va tu thuc vo loi v kch c
ca ng cha cp, bin dng ca ng cp, quy trnh bm va v thit b s dng, thng ti a l 30m.
A hole is drilled/cut through the top surface of the duct at each vent location for the passage of the grout from the
duct through the vent. The plastic vent is fixed by tie wire and sealed using tape.
Mt l khoan c khoan xuyn qua b mt trn ca ng cp ti tng v tr t van bm va c th i vo ng
cha cp qua van bm va. Van bm v a c c nh bng dy thp buc v qun cht bng bng dnh.

2.8. Grout Mixture / Hn hp va


The grout consists of / Hn hp va bao gm:

Portland Cement PCB-40 in 50 kg bag

Trang 8/37
TN D AN

METHOD STATEMENT
BIN PHP THI CNG CP D NG LC

NAMCONG ENGINEERING CORPORATION

Ximng Portland PCB-40 trong bao 50 kg


Potable Water
Nc sch
Grout Additive Sika Intraplast Z-HV
Ph gia Sika Intraplast Z -HV cho va
Grout Additive Sikament NN
Ph gia Sikament NN cho va
Grout mix trials should be performed prior to grouting of tendons in order to establish the most suitable mix.
Va phi c th nghim trc khi bm xc nh t l thch hp.
Proposed grout mix proportion / T l trn va cp phi c ngh l:

Cement /Xi mng Water/ Nc sch Sika Intraplast Z-HV Sikament NN

100kg 34 lit 0.6 kg 1.0 lit

Technical requirements / Yu cu k thut:

Viscosity 25 sec.
chy 25 sec.

Volume change of the grout: -1% n +5% initial volume.


co ngt (thay i th tch) ca va t -1% n +5% so vi th tch ban u.
Compressive cube strength shall be not less than 30 Mpa at 28 days or 27 Mpa at 7 days if it is proposed to
estimate the likely 28 day strength at 7 days. (BS EN 447-2007)
Cng nn ca mu va sau 28 ngy ti thiu phi t 30 Mpa hoc 2 7 Mpa ti thi im 7 ngy trong
trng hp c xut nh gi cng nn ti thi im 28 ngy da vo cng nn ti thi im 7
ngy. (BS EN 447-2007)

Mixing time min. 4 minutes


Thi gian trn ti thiu 4 pht

4. BASIC DATA FOR FRICTION AND ELONGATION CALCULATION / C S D LIU TNH


TON MA ST V DN DI CA CP
Friction coefficient : 0.3
H s ma st : 0.3
Wobble coefficient k : 0.004
H s chch hng k : 0.004
Draw-in of wedge : 6mm (mean value)
Khong tt nm : 6mm (gi tr danh nh)
Loss in stressing anchorage : 3% (mean value)
Lc mt ti u neo ko : 3% (Gi tr danh nh)

7.3. Installation Live End Anchorages / Lp t h u neo ko loi dp


Live end anchorage is connected with the recess former by tie wire and plastic tape. The casting is tied
to the duct by steel wire. The casting and recess former shall be fixed to the slab side form conforming
to design elevation shown in the shop drawing. The plastic recess former should be oiled prior to
concrete. Ensure the grout inlet is at the top of casting. (by Namcong)
H neo ko c ni vi u hc bng km buc v bng keo. Thn neo c but vo ng km bng
thp si. Thn neo v u hc nha c gn c nh vo vn khun thnh ct pha theo nh bn v
thit k. Khun hc u neo phi c bi trn trc khi b t ng. m bo l bm va trn thn
neo phi quay ln pha trn. (bi Namcong)
A suitable hole should be made on side of formwork at casting position to be outlet of protruding
strands, i.e. the strands can be pushed through out of formwork after threading. (by MC)

7.4. Definition of Tendon Profiles / nh hnh bin dng cong ca ng cp
Bar chairs are provided at regular intervals of 800 mm up to 1200 mm spacing or as specified by the
Designer are laid and fixed on the bottom of formwork and secured to the reinforcement with tie wires.(by Namcong)
Khong cch thng thng gia cc con k l 800mm ti 1 200mm hoc theo quy nh c th ca ngi
thit k, t trn vn khun y v c gn cht vo ct thp bng dy thp buc. (bi Namcong)
The ducts should be fastened properly to the bar chairs by tie wire in order to avoid displacement during
concreting. Do not fasten so tight that any damage occurs. (by Namcong)
ng cha cp c c nh vi con k bng dy thp buc trnh b di chuyn tro ng qu trnh
btng. Tuy nhin khng nn ct qu cht s lm hng ng. (bi Namcong)
Deviation from the theoretical cable axis (placing tolerance of duct) should not exceed 5 mm vertically
and 100 mm horizontally. (by Namcong)
lch ca trc cp cho php so vi l thuyt khng c qu 5mm theo phng ng v 100mm
theo phng ngang. (bi Namcong)
The Main Contractor should ensure that all rebar works has been finished correctly within acceptable
tolerances, especially highest and lowest points. The incorrect rebar arrangement may cause the
exceeding deviation of PT tendons. (by MC)
Nh Thu Chnh phi m bo rng tt c cc ct thp c lp t xong ng theo dung sai cho
php, c bit l cc im cao nht v thp nht. B tr thp sai c th gy ra lch vt qu i vi
cc ng cp d ng lc. (bi MC)
Check visually axis of tendons and fixation at supports before concreting. Repair any damages with tape
and tie wire. (by MC, Namcong)
Kim tra trc ng cp bng mt v cc v tr trc khi btng. Sa cha cc ch h hng bng
bng dnh v dy thp buc. (bi MC,Namcong)

8. STRESSING OF TENDONS / KO CNG NG CP


(Items marked by MC should be done by the Main Contractor)
(Cc cng vic c nh du bi MC s do nh thu chnh thc hin)
8.1. Basic Data for Friction & Elongation Caculation/ C s tinh ton ma st/gin di
8.1.1. Calculation of Modified Expected Extension/ Tnh ton gin di k vng

a L1 = (PL / A1E1)

where L1 = theoretical extension/Gin di l thuyt


E1 = 1.95 x 105 N/mm2
A1 = 98.7 mm2

Trang 18/37
TN D AN

METHOD STATEMENT
BIN PHP THI CNG CP D NG LC

NAMCONG ENGINEERING CORPORATION

b L2 = (PL / A2E2)

where L2 = modified theoretical extension/Gin di l thuyt hiu


chnh
E2 = actual E value from mill certificate of
the respective heat and coil of strand/Gi tr E thc t ly t
chng ch xut xng ca cp.
A2 = actual cross-sectional area from mill certificate
of the respective heat and coil of strand/Tit din thc t ly
t chng ch xut xng ca cp.

c (L1 / L2) = [ (PL / A1E1) / (PL / A2E2) ]

Therefore L2 = L1 x (A1E1 / A2E2)

8.1.2. Calculation of Stressing Report/Tnh ton bo co ko cng

a Elastic shortening of strand over jack length/Co n hi trong kch

PL = stressing force x length of jack


AE total area of strand x E value of strand

b Total extension = Y + Z ( Tng gin di )

Z = Y x IP
(FP - IP)

where Y = Cumulative measured extension/Gin di o c cng dn


Z = Initial incremental measurement/Gin di o ban u
FP = Final pressure/p lc cui
IP = Initial pressure/p lc ban u

c Actual extension/Gin di thc t

(Total extension) minus (Elastic shortening of strand over jack length)


minus (Far end slip in (if any))/Bng tng gin di tr i gin di
trong kch tr i khong trt nm nu c

d % variation of extension/Phn trm gin di thay i

(actual extension - modified expected extension) x 100%


modified expected extension

e Wedge draw-in/ tt nm

(Stroke difference at lock off pressure)


minus
(Elastic shortening of strand over jack length)/Khong cch dich chuyn lc kha p lc tr i gin di
ca cp trong kch

8.2. Preparation for Stressing / Chun b cho ko cng


Check the validity of the jack and gauge calibration certificate. If it is over 10 months, the jacks and
gauges should be calibrated before sending to the job site for stressing operation. The jack should be
recalibrated every 10 months. (by Namcong)

8.3. Stressing of Flat Tendons / Ko cng cc ng cp loi b dp


Stressing is carried out one-by-one of strands in each tendon. (by Namcong)
Ko cng cp c thc hin tng si mt ti mi ng cp. (bi Namcong)
Carefully check the working condition of hydraulic pump, stressing jack and gauge, power source,
hydraulic hoses connection and so on to ensure a good working for whole system. (by Namcong)
Kim tra cn thn tnh trng ca my bm thu lc, kch ko cng v ng h o, ngun in, ti -o thu
lc m bo ton b h thng trong tnh trng lm vic bnh thng. (bi Namcong)
A reference point for extension measurement is marked on every strand by painting and using a
template (Ruler). (by Namcong)
Mt im chun cho vic o dn di c nh du ln tt c cc si cp bng sn hoc bt xa v
thc. (bi Namcong)

The recess plate for wedges draw-in is threaded through the strand and set on top of the anchor block. (by Namcong)
Tm chn nm (cn gi l u m) c lun qua si cp, sau p st vo mt u neo. (bi Namcong)

Trang 20/37
TN D AN

METHOD STATEMENT
BIN PHP THI CNG CP D NG LC

NAMCONG ENGINEERING CORPORATION

The jack is then threaded through the strand and set on top of the recess plate. General practice is that
the jack is installed by means of hand. (by Namcong)
Kch c lun qua cp ri p st vo u m, vic lp kch thng thng c thc hin bng tay. (bi Namcong)
Apply an initial force, usually 5MPa, to eliminate the slack of the strands. Then Stressing at 100%
design force. Release the pressure back to zero and then removed the hydraulic stressing jack from the
stressed strand. (by Namcong)
Qu trnh ko cng c bt u, thc hin ko 5MPa kh chng cc si cp. Sau ko cng n
100% lc thit k, gim p lc v 0 v hi kch. (bi Namcong)
The jack and recess plate is then removed. (by Namcong)
Tho kch v u m (bi Namcong)
The elongation is measured by the painting marks on strand after the stressing in the tendon. Place the
template (ruler) on strand then spray a new painting mark, the elongation is distance taken from the new
mark to the old mark. (by Namcong)
dn di c o bi cc im vch sn trn si cp sau khi ko xong mt ng cp . t dng
(thc) ln si cp v nh du mt vch sn mi, dn di ca si cp chnh l khong cch gia
vch sn mi v vch sn c. (bi Namcong)

Record the stressing force and extension (elongation) of strands to Tendon Stressing Report for Flat
Tendon (by Namcong)
Ghi l i lc ko cng v dn di ca cc si cp vo Bo co kt qu cng cp cho ng cp dp (bi Namcong)
Repeat all the steps for the other strands. (by Namcong)
Lp li cc bc nh trn cho cc si cp khc. (bi Namcong)
Stressing report should be calculated, completed and checked by Namcong's Project Engineer prior to
submission to the Engineer for approval in Tendon Stressing Calculation for Flat Tendon. The strands
should not be cut without approval. (by Namcong)
Bo co ko cng v dn di s tnh ton, hon chnh v kim tra bi k s d n Namcong, trc
khi trnh cho t vn duyt trong Bo co tnh ton cng cp cho ng cp dp. Cp tha ngoi u
neo s khng c ct cho n khi c s ng ca t vn. (bi Namcong)

8.5. Acceptance Tolerances of Tendon Elongation / Dung sai gin di ca ng cp.
For longer Tendon than 15m, <10% on an individual strands, but not more than 7% on the average of
all strand in a Tendon.
i vi ng cp c chiu di > 15m, gin di gii hn 10% trn mi si cp nhng khng qu
7% trn gin di trung bnh ca cc si cp trong mt ng cp.
For less Tendon than 15m, <15% on an individual strands, but not more than 10% on the average of all
strand in a Tendon.

9.3. Grouting Procedure / Quy trnh bm va

Grout is pumped from one end of tendon and grout expelled from the grout hoses should be checked
until no more air bubble and the consistency of the grout is similar to that in the mixer before
closing off the hoses. (by Namcong)
Va c bm t mt u ca ng cp v phi kim tra va ti cc u ra cho n khi va
khng cn bt kh v ng u ca va ging nh trong my trn trc khi ng ng. (bi Namcong)

Grouting of each tendon should be carried out in one continuous operation. If grouting is interrupted
for more than 30 minutes, the tendon should be flushed with water and mpressed air in order to
clear the grout before resuming the grouting operation. (by Namcong)
Qu trnh bm va cho mi ng cp nn c thc hin mt cch lin tc. Nu qu trnh b
ngng gia chng trn 30 pht, ng cp cn phi lm sch bng nc v thi bng kh trc khi
bt u bm li t u. (by Namcong)

After the grout is seen flowing from the other end of the tendon, i.e. the entire tendon is filled, the
grout hoses are closed. Maintenance the pressure inside tendon about 10-15 second. (by Namcong)
Sau khi va chy ra u kia ca ng cp, ngha l ton b ng cp c bm y, cc
ng bm va c ng li. Tip t c duy tr p lc bm trong vng 10 -15 giy th kha vi bm. (bi Namcong)

The grouting nozzle should be transferred to the next already filled hose and grouting should be
continued from there. (by Namcong)
Vic bm va by gi c th c chuyn sang ng cp k tip. (bi Namcong)

The grout hose can be cutted after 24hours Grouting. (by Namcong)
Tt c cc vi bm va c th c ct b 24h sau khi bm va. (bi Namcong)

Record the grouting procedure in Tendon Grouting Report. (by Namcong)

10. GROUT TEST / TH VA


(Items marked by MC should be done by the Main Contractor)
(Cc cng vic c nh du bi MC s do Nh Thu chnh thc hin)
10.1. Viscosity / chy
Viscosity test will be executed by means of a flow cone (EN 445-2007). Flow time is measured with
a stop-watch. Time is grouting out-flow cone about 01 litre.. Measurement is carried out directly
and 4 minutes after mixing, flow time should be less than 25 seconds. (by Namcong)
Kim tra chy ca va bng phu hnh cn (EN 445-2007). Thi gian chy c o bng ng
h bm giy. chy ca va l thi gian t lc va bt u chy n lc va chy ra khi
phu c 01 lt. Vic o c c thc hin ti ch, khong 4 pht sau khi trn va, thi gian
chy ca va phi nh hn 25 giy. (bi Namcong)
This test should be done for each batch of grout mix. (by Namcong)
Th nghim ny c tin hnh cho mi m trn. (bi Namcong)
10.2. Compressive Strength / Cng chu nn

After filling with grout the mould (40x40x160 mm) should be covered with a nylon bundle. Six
specimens per eight-hour shift are required. After 18 to 24 hours remove cubes from the mould and
store them in a humid place or in water. Compressive strength shall be measured; three samples
should be tested on each test. According to specification, Compressive cube strength shall be not
less than 30 Mpa at 28 days or 27 Mpa at 7 days if it is proposed to estimate the likely 28 day
strength at 7 days. (by Namcong)
Sau khi y va, khun c mu (khi lp phng 40x40x160 mm) c bao bc li bng ny
lng. Mi ca lm vic 8h ly 6 mu (6 vin). Sau 18 n 24h tho mu ra khi khun v bo qun
mu trong mi trng m hoc ngm trong nc. Mi ln th ngh im cng chu nn cho 3 mu.
Theo tiu chun, cng nn ca mu va sau 28 ngy ti thiu phi t 30 Mpa hoc 27 Mpa ti
thi im 7 ngy trong trng hp xut nh gi cng nn ti thi im 28 ngy da vo
cng nn ti thi im 7 ngy . (bi Namcong)

11. REPAIR / REMEDIAL METHODS / BIN PHP SA CHA


11.1. Installation & pouring concrete problems / Cc vn xy ra khi lp t v b tng
Damage of Strand / Khuyt tt cp:
The main reason is during welding. Need to work closely with the MC, coffa and reinforcement teams to avoid
this problem. If the strand is damaged due to welding, need to replace the new one before pour concrete if
require.
Nguyn nhn ch yu dn n vic cc si cp b khuyt tt l do b dnh hn x trong qu trnh thi cng. Cn
lm vic cht ch vi Nh thu chnh v cc i coffa, ct thp hn ch vn ny. Nu si cp b dnh hn
x th cn phi thay th si cp mi trc khi btng.

Damage of Duct / Khuyt tt ng gen:


When the Duct is damaged before concreting that can be affected the stressing works or grouting works, must
be treated before concreting.
Khi ng ghen cha cp b khuyt tt c pht hin trc qu trnh b tng m c th nh hng ti qu
trnh ko cng hoc bm va th phi tin hnh x l trc khi btng.

Honeycomb found at the anchorage after pouring concrete / R t ong ti khu vc neo sau khi b tng:
Need to exposure to see all of the void and fill up by SikaGrout 214-11, wait for minimum 3 day in order to
reach minimum required strength before start the stressing work.
Cn phi c xung quanh l r tt c cc l rng sau b bng SikaGrout 214-11, i ti thiu 3 ngy
t cng ti thiu yu cu trc khi cng ko.

11.2. Stressing problem: Broken strand, slippage strand / Cc vn khi cng ko: t, tut cp
In case of strand broken / Trng hp t cp:
We have two options. First is check the structure working if missing one of the strands by Namcong designer
and advise for solution for approval or possible overstressing of adjacent tendons within the limits of the
admissible stresses. The second is to replace the broken strand by a new one if can be.
Chng ta c 2 la chn. u tin l chng ta kim tra xem kt cu lm vic nh th no nu mt i mt trong
nhng si cp bi thit k ca Nam Cng hoc ko b cc si cp cn li trong ng cp v cc ng
cp bn cnh trong gii hn cho php v trnh ph duyt. Th hai l thay cp t bng mt cp mi nu c
th.

Stressing elongation is out of tolerance / gin di vt qu gii hn cho php


If in negative side, additional stressing will be carried out at 103%xForce Design, Finishing.
Nu gin di thc t ca si cp m vt qu gii hn cho php th tin hnh ko b cho si cp vi
lc ko bng 103% lc ko thit k v kt thc vic x l ko cng y.
If in positive side, Checking the working of tendon by stressing at Force Design again will stressing the tendon
at Force Design again. If the Force of the Tendon no change So that the Tendon is normal working, Finishing.
Conversely, should check all issues can be related to stressing result..
Nu gin di thc t ca si cp dng vt qu gii hn cho php th tin hnh ko th lc vi lc ko
ng bng lc thit k. Nu lc ca si cp khng thay i th chng t si cp vn chu lc bnh thng, kt
thc vic x l. Ngc li cn kim tra li tt c cc thng s nh hng n kt qu cng ko.

Dead end is pulled out due to honeycomb or other reason / u cht b tut v r t ong hoc l do no khc:
Need to immediately stop stressing, chip out to check for dead end, then filling up by SikaGrout 214-11 prior to
stressing / Cn phi ngng ko cng ngay lp tc, c b b tng kim tra u cht sau b SikaGrout
214-11 trc khi cng ko li.

Stuck at stressing end due to vibration damage anchorage sealing, hence concrete leaks into tendon. This need
to clear out all of debris concrete inside the anchorage before stressing.
Kt u cng ko v m di b tng lm hng mi ni ch u neo nn b tng lt vo ng cp. Cn phi
c b tt c b tng bn trong neo trc khi cng ko.

11.3. Grouting problem: stuck at grout hose, tendon blocked / Cc vn khi bm va: tc vi, tc ng cp
If stuck found at any hose, need to clear it out before start grouting on that tendon.
Nu nh tc bt k vi no th cn phi thng vi trc khi bm va.

Outlet hose stuck during grouting process need to use drilling machine directly at stuck point, or try to inject
grout from other inlet hose to blow out the stuck object. Need to report to Consultant for approval before
repairing.
Nu nh vi ra b tc trong qu trnh bm th c n phi dng my khoan ngay ti im b tc hoc c gng bm
t vi khc thng ng. Cn phi bo co TVGS chp thun trc khi sa cha.

Grout is leaking during grouting process, pressure is dropped down, need to use quick setting Sika material to
close the leaking point, keep continue grouting work.
Va b r r trong qu trnh bm, p l c b gim, cn phi chun b sn Sika trm ch r, tip tc bm.

16. APPENDIX B: CARE OF DUCTS AND TENDONS DURING CONCRETING / PH LC B: BO V


NG CHA CP V NG CP KHI B TNG

For the purposes of avoiding potential problem areas that may occur on site the main contractor is reminded of his
responsibilities in the care of Namcong ducts or tendons during the concreting phase of works.
trnh nhng s c c kh nng xy ra ti cc khu vc c ng cp ca Nam Cng trn cng trng, Nh Thu chnh
phi c trch nhim ch n ng cha cp v ng cp ca NAMCONG trong giai on t thp v b tng.
This Appendix is extremely important as for the interest of the contract as an attempt to prevent problems occurring during
the concreting phase and prior to or during the stressing operation.
Ph lc n y rt quan trng nh l mt phn hiu lc ca hp ng nhm c gng trnh xy ra s c i vi ng cp v
ng cp trc v trong khi b tng hoc trong khi vn hnh ko cng.
The following steps should be taken to minimize the Main Contractors risk of untimely site problems:
gim thiu cc ri ro do v c th xy ra i vi Nh Thu chnh, Nh Thu chnh cn tun th cc bc sau:
- Prior to concreting, the supervisor must familiarize himself with the layout of cables and advice the concretors of
critical areas where the reinforcement and cable arrangement is particularly congested.
Trc khi b tng, cc gim st vin nm r mt bng b tr ng cp v phi c hng dn ngi b tng
trnh nhng v tr nguy him, ni ct thp v ng cp c b tr dy c.
- Throughout the concreting operation adequate chairs and planking should be used to bridge over the prestressing ducts
and prevent construction loads from damaging the ducts. Typical construction loads include concrete pumping
equipment, hand tools and treading of workers.
Trong sut qu trnh b tng phi s dng cc tm vn k trn cc chn lm cu bc qua cc ng ng cp
d ng lc trnh cc ti trng khi thi cng gy hng ng cp. Cc ti trng khi thi cng bao gm thit b bm b tng,
dng c cm tay v phng cng nhn dm ln ng.
- Vibrators of suitable diameters should be used in areas having limited spacing, especially in between ducts and
reinforcement, otherwise indentation of ducts will occur.
Phi s dng cc loi m b tng c ng knh thch hp ti nhng khu vc c din tch hn ch, c bit l
nhng ch gia ng cp d ng lc v ct thp nu khng c th dn n lm bp ng.
- All poker vibrators should be labeled with color marks for the gauging of depth of penetration. This will enable the
supervisor to monitor, control and ensure correct placing and compaction of concrete around the post - tensioning
components.
Tt c nhng loi m di phi c nh du bng sn mu nh du su m. Vic ny cho php cc gim
st vin c th kim sot v m bo c qu trnh v m b tng xung quanh khu vc c h thng d ng lc.
- Concrete should be poured layer by layer. This will increase the visibility and worker awareness of cables and ducts.
B tng nn mt cch t t. Vic ny gip cho cng nhn c th d dng nhn thy ton b ng cp v ng cp
trong khi .
- If the ducts are covered by a thin layer of concrete, compaction of concrete can be performed reasonably well without
damaging the adjacent ducts.
Trng hp c mt lp mng b tng ph trn ng cp, nn m b tng va phi trnh khng lm bp hay sai lch
ng cp.
- Rigorous or abrupt dipping / pulling of poker vibrator should be avoided. This will cause the poker vibrator to bounce
off the reinforcement, and puncture or dent the ducts. The golden rule for dipping / pulling the poker vibrator is fade
in and fade out.
Trnh dm hoc y qu mnh, t ngt cc loi m di. m qu mnh s gy ct thp chc thng hoc lm rch
ng cp. Mt nguyn tc c bn trong khi m l y xung v rt ra t t.
- Furthermore, the poker vibrator should not be blindly submerged into the concrete without knowing where the cables
are located.
Hn na, khng c php m b tng m khng bit c ng ng cp d ng lc hay khng.
- Concrete should not be discharged directly onto the duct.
